Good decision. Bear in mind weekends pose extra challenges to your quit in terms of triggers.
A couple suggestions:
1. go to your quit group, say hello, and post roll. (if your quit starts today you are in December 15, is you started August 5 you are in the November group. you may need to update your profile quit date) The day you flush your tobacco down the toilet is day 1.
2. get active. get some phone numbers from your quit group to text to each other as temptations arise. Spend time on KTC reading when the craves arrive. Get mad on the forums and chat rooms here rather than at home.
Quit on. The "flu" won't kill you, and it will get better.
